ASTANA. May 19 (Interfax-Kazakhstan) — Kazakhstan's Energy Ministry has begun preparatory work to formulate proposals for the further development of the Tengiz field after 2033, balancing the interests of the state and investors, the ministry told Interfax-Kazakhstan.
